Handover note — Crumbwheel order cutoffs.

Welcome aboard. The bakery cutoff rule in Crumbwheel closes same-day orders at 14:00 local to each storefront, not UTC — this has bitten us twice. Holiday overrides live in the calendar service and take precedence silently, so always check there first when a cutoff looks wrong. To unlock the calendar service's admin console after a restart, enter the recovery passphrase below.

vault phrase of bagap-bahaf = silion-pelox-sorox-casdor-quenwyn-fraax-eliox-praael-kelion-quenvan-kasox-rusael-norius-belvan

Release runbook, step 6 — PickPath Optimizer v3.1. Confirm the batching heuristics pass the Larkwell warehouse regression suite, then freeze the candidate build. Tag the release in the artifact store and notify the floor-ops liaison at Durnmont Logistics that cutover starts at 02:00. Before promotion, the deploy pipeline must verify the artifact against the current release credential. Sign the bundle using the key below.

rollout seal: bky4_x7Gc

## Deployment

Deploying the cron-drift probe for Quenholm Scheduler requires care: the probe itself must not introduce timing noise, so deploy only during the maintenance window and verify the host clock is synced first. Roll out one node at a time and compare drift reports before proceeding. The probe reads its thresholds and reporting endpoint from the configuration below.

config for haweg-bagag:
[kasath]
host = kasath.qirvancorp.internal
user = kasath_svc
database = kasath_prod